× Website Hosting
Terms of use Privacy Policy

File Transfer Protocol (FTP, Server)



dns

FTP (file transfer protocol), is the standard protocol for moving computer files from a remote server to a client. It is a separate protocol that uses control and data connections. It is commonly used to transfer large files (e.g. videos) from one computer or another. It's based on the client/server model.

Passive mode ftp server

Passive mode offers FTP server clients and FTP server clients an alternative to firewalls blocking incoming connections. Passive mode uses two random unprivileged ports to enable the transfer of data between the client and the server. Passive mode will be the default setting for WinSCP.


web hosting hub complaints

Active mode ftp server

A FTP server in Active mode is different than a passive mode. Active mode is when the client sends a port number and the server connects to it. In passive mode, the server opens a port and waits for a client to connect.

File transfer protocol (FTP)

A File Transfer Protocol (FTP) server can be used to store and transfer data between clients and servers. This protocol is used to transfer computer files. It uses separate control and data connections for data transfer from one end to another.


NATs

FTP servers using NATs can present a problem for many reasons. The routing devices must understand the protocol to dynamically modify the control link. A state information must be maintained for data connections. The internal server is transparently rerouted packets from acceptable external addresses.

Firewalls

There are two common types of firewalls: one on the client side and one on the server side. The former is used when a server is on a private network while the latter is used when it is on a network that is public. The major difference is that the former blocks all traffic, except for well-known ports. FTP clients cannot therefore connect to the servers.


ssl cert

Protocol client-server

FTP is a client/server protocol that allows users send and receive files between computers. FTP comes in two main modes. There is an ASCII mode that allows text to be sent, which uses 8 bits per line, and a binary mode that allows images to be sent, which uses 36 bits per line. Both modes can be specified in the server's settings or in an allow rule. ASCII mode sends the file byte for byte to the sending machine, and the recipient stores the file once it has received it.




FAQ

What is a website static?

Static websites are those where all content is stored on a web server and can be accessed by users via their web browsers.

The term "static", refers to the absence or modification of images, video, animations, and so forth.

This site was originally intended for corporate intranets. However it has since been adopted and modified by small businesses and individuals who require simple websites without complex programming.

Static sites have become increasingly popular because they require less maintenance. They are much easier to maintain than fully-featured sites with many components (such a blog).

They also tend to load faster than their dynamic counterparts. This makes them ideal for users on mobile devices or those with slow Internet connections.

In addition, static sites are more secure than their dynamic equivalents. You can't hack into a static site. Hackers only have access the data in a database.

There are two main options for creating a static website.

  1. Utilizing a Content Management System.
  2. How to create a static HTML website

The best one for you will depend on your specific needs. A CMS is the best choice for anyone who is new to building websites.

Why? Because you have complete control over your website. With a CMS, you don't need to hire someone to help you set up your site. You just need to upload files to your web server.

Still, you can learn to code and create static websites. But you'll need to invest some time learning how to program.


What should I include in my Portfolio?

All these items should be part of your portfolio.

  • Exemplaires of previous work
  • If possible, links to your site
  • Links to your blog.
  • Links to social media pages.
  • Links to online portfolios of other designers.
  • Any awards that you have received.
  • References.
  • Examples of your work.
  • Links showing how you communicate with clients.
  • These links show that you are open to learning new technologies.
  • These are links that show your flexibility
  • You can find links that reflect your personality.
  • Videos showing your skills.


Can I make my website using HTML and CSS?

Yes! Yes!

After you have learned how to structure a website, you will need to know HTML and CSS.

HTML stands to represent HyperText Markup Language. This is like writing a recipe. It would include ingredients, instructions, as well as directions. HTML is a way to tell a computer which parts are bold, underlined, italicized or linked to other parts of the document. It's the language for documents.

CSS stands as Cascading Stylesheets. You can think of CSS as a style sheet for recipes. Instead of listing all ingredients and instructions, you simply write down the basic rules for things such as font sizes, colors or spacing.

HTML tells the browser how a page should look; CSS tells it what to do.

You don't have to be a prodigy if you don’t get the terms. Follow these steps to make beautiful websites.


Should I use WordPress or a website builder?

Start small to create a strong web presence. If you have all the resources and time, then build a website. If you don't have the resources to build a full-fledged site, a blog may be the best choice. As you develop your website design skills, you can always add additional features.

But before you build your first website, you should set up a primary domain name. This will give you a pointer to which to publish content.


What does a UI designer do?

The interface design team for software products is called a user interface (UI). They are responsible for designing the layout and visual elements of an application. Graphic designers may also be part of the UI designer.

The UI Designer needs to be a problem solver and have a good understanding of how people use computers.

A UI designer needs to be passionate about software and technology. He/she should be familiar with all aspects in the field, from creating ideas to implementing them into code.

They should be capable of creating designs using a variety tools and techniques. They should be able problem solve and think creatively.

They should be detail-oriented and well organized. They should be able develop prototypes quickly, efficiently and accurately.

They should feel at ease working with clients, large and small. They should be able, and willing, to adapt in different environments and situations.

They should be able to communicate effectively with others. They should be able to express their thoughts clearly and concisely.

They should be well-rounded and possess strong communication abilities.

They must be driven, motivated, and highly motivated.

They should be passionate about what they do.


How to design a website?

Your customers will first need to understand the purpose of your website. What are your customers looking for?

What other problems could they face if they can't find the information they need on your website?

Once you know this, you must figure out how to solve those problems. It is also important to ensure your site looks great. It should be easy-to-use and navigate.

It is important to have a professional-looking website. It should not take too much time to load. If it does take too long, people won't stay as long as they would like to. They'll leave and go elsewhere.

You need to consider where your products are located when you build an eCommerce website. Do they all reside in one spot? Are they all in one place?

It's important to decide if you want to sell just one product or multiple products. Do you want to sell just one type of product or multiple kinds?

After you've answered these questions, it is possible to start building your website.

Now it is time for you to concentrate on the technical aspect of things. How will your website work? Is it fast enough? Can they access it quickly via their computers?

Will they be able buy anything without having pay an extra fee? Will they have to register with your company before they can buy something?

These are vital questions you need to ask. Once you know the answers to these questions, you'll be ready to move forward.


How much do web developers make?

The hourly rate for a website you create yourself is $60-$80. You can charge more if you're an independent contractor. The hourly rate could be anywhere from $150 to $200



Statistics

  • When choosing your website color scheme, a general rule is to limit yourself to three shades: one primary color (60% of the mix), one secondary color (30%), and one accent color (10%). (wix.com)
  • It enables you to sell your music directly on your website and keep 100% of the profits. (wix.com)
  • At this point, it's important to note that just because a web trend is current, it doesn't mean it's necessarily right for you.48% of people cite design as the most important factor of a website, (websitebuilderexpert.com)
  • Is your web design optimized for mobile? Over 50% of internet users browse websites using a mobile device. (wix.com)
  • It's estimated that chatbots could reduce this by 30%. Gone are the days when chatbots were mere gimmicks – now, they're becoming ever more essential to customer-facing services. (websitebuilderexpert.com)



External Links

interaction-design.org


webflow.com


w3.org


linkedin.com




How To

How can I start as a UI Designer

There are two ways to become a UI designer:

  1. You can complete school to earn a degree for UI Design.
  2. You can become a freelancer.

If you want to go through school, you'll need to attend college or university and complete four years of study. This covers art, business, psychology, and computer science.

You can also enroll in classes at state universities or community colleges. Some schools offer tuition-free programs while others charge tuition.

You'll need to find work once you have graduated. If you are going to be working for yourself, you will need to build your client list. You should network with other professionals to let them know that you exist.

Opportunities to intern in web development companies are available. Many companies employ interns to gain practical experience before hiring full time employees.

You will find more jobs if you have a portfolio that showcases your work. Your portfolio should include work samples as well as details of the projects that you have worked on.

It is a good idea for potential employers to receive your portfolio via email.

Being a freelancer means you need to market yourself. You can advertise your services on job boards like Indeed, Freelance, Guru, or Upwork.

Freelancers frequently receive assignments from recruiters who post jobs online. These recruiters look for qualified candidates to fill specific positions.

These recruiters usually provide a briefing outlining the requirements of the job to the candidate.

Freelancers are not required by law to sign any long-term agreements. It is best to negotiate an upfront fee if you intend to move forward.

Many designers prefer to work directly and not through agencies. Although this might seem like a great idea, many people lack the necessary skills.

Agency workers are often well-versed in the industry they work in. They also have access special training and resources that help them produce high-quality work.

Agency workers often receive higher hourly rates in addition to these benefits.

The downside to working with an agency is that you won't have direct contact with the employer.

To succeed as a UI designer, you must be self-motivated, creative, organized, flexible, detail-oriented, analytical, and communicative.

Excellent communication skills are also required.

UI designers create user interfaces and visual elements for websites.

They are also responsible to ensure the site meets user needs.

This involves understanding the information users need and how to make your site work.

Wireframes are created by UI designers using a variety of tools. Before they begin designing, wireframing allows them to visualize the page's layout.

It is easy to create your own wireframes using the online templates.

Some designers focus solely on UI design, while others combine UI design with graphic design.

Photoshop is used to edit images by graphic designers.

Adobe InDesign is used to create layouts and pages.

Photographers capture images using digital cameras or DSLRs.

The photos are then uploaded to a photo editing software where text captions, filters and other effects can be added.

Afterward, the photographer saves the image in a file format compatible with the website.

It is vital to consider all aspects in the web design process.

This includes research and planning, wireframing, prototyping testing, coding, content creation and publishing.

Research - Before you start a new project, it's important to do thorough research.

Planning - Once you've completed your research, you'll want to begin developing a plan.

Wireframing – A wireframe is a preliminary sketch or drawing of a webpage or application.

Prototyping - Prototypes help ensure that the final product matches the initial vision.

Testing - Multiple rounds of testing should be done on the prototype to make sure it works properly.

Coding - Coding is the act of writing computer code.

Content Creation – Content creation includes everything, from the writing of copy to managing social networks accounts.

Publishing entails uploading files to a server and ensuring the site is accessible.

You will need to have a broad knowledge of different projects in order as a freelance UX/UI developer.

Some companies may only need wire frames while others require complete prototypes.

You might be required to do certain tasks, depending on what type of project it is.

For example, if you're hired to create wireframes, you might be expected to create several wireframes over time.

If you're being hired to create a full prototype, you might be asked to create a fully functional site.

No matter what type of project you are working on, it is important to have good interpersonal skills.

Referring freelancers is the best way to get work. It's important to establish good relationships with potential employers.

Furthermore, you should be able and able to communicate both verbally AND in writing.

A portfolio is an important component of any freelancers' arsenal.

It showcases the quality of your work as well as your ability and willingness to provide high-quality results.

Online portfolios can help you do this.

You can find similar websites to yours online to help you get started.

Next, search these sites to discover which site offers what services.

After identifying the best practices that you believe to be most successful, you can go ahead and implement them.

It's also useful to include links from your portfolio in your resume.




 



File Transfer Protocol (FTP, Server)